Kubota Overspeed Shutdown

Generator attempts to start but stops with E03 displayed, engine speed surges briefly before shutdown.

Possible Causes

Faulty engine speed sensor (magnetic pickup), Loose or damaged flywheel ring gear teeth, Defective governor actuator, Incorrect controller speed calibration

How to Fix / Troubleshooting

Safety first: Disable automatic start, disconnect battery negative, and keep hands clear of rotating parts.

  • Inspect speed sensor: Locate the magnetic pickup sensor near the flywheel ring gear. Check for metal debris on the sensor tip and clean it with a lint-free cloth. Ensure the air gap to the ring gear matches Kubota specifications (typically 0.5–1.0 mm). Adjust if needed.
  • Check wiring: Follow the speed sensor harness back to the Kubota controller. Look for cuts, abrasions, or loose connectors. Repair or replace damaged wiring.
  • Inspect flywheel teeth: Rotate the engine by hand (using the crankshaft pulley bolt) and visually inspect ring gear teeth through the sensor opening. If many teeth are damaged or missing, the flywheel may need replacement (technician recommended).
  • Governor actuator check: Observe the electronic governor actuator linkage at the fuel injection pump. Ensure linkage moves smoothly and is not binding. Lubricate pivot points lightly and verify return springs are intact.
  • Controller settings: In the Kubota controller menu (if accessible), verify rated speed (e.g., 1800 RPM for 60 Hz) is correctly configured. Do not change advanced parameters unless you have the service manual.
  • Test run: Reconnect battery, clear E03, and start the generator while monitoring frequency and voltage. If overspeed persists, contact a qualified technician.
